What are non-degree studies at Cornell?
The Non-degree Studies program is a way for you to earn college credit at Cornell without enrolling in a degree. Whether you want to study a particular subject with Cornell faculty, explore a new interest, or strengthen your professional skills, you can choose from thousands of regular university courses year-round. Non-degree Studies are open to anyone 18 and older who is not currently a Cornell degree candidate. Read more about Non-degree Studies.
Flexible year-round learning
Study part time or full time, on campus or online, during any season.
Work with some of the brightest, most accomplished experts in their fields – instructors who share a passion for learning that’s contagious.
Explore an academic field, take a career-oriented course, add a Cornell course to your resume.
Receive an official Cornell transcript and credits that are generally transferable toward a degree at Cornell or elsewhere.
